Buttery, snowy, and irresistibly tender, these Vegan Russian Tea Cakes melt in your mouth with every bite. Also known as Mexican Wedding Cookies or Snowball Cookies, these classic treats get a plant-based twist without sacrificing their nostalgic charm. Perfect for holiday trays, tea parties, or cozy afternoon baking, their simple ingredient list and crumbly texture make them a crowd favorite.
Made with a nutty base and a generous dusting of powdered sugar, these cookies are naturally egg-free and easily dairy-free. Whether you’re new to vegan baking or a seasoned pro, you’ll love how quickly these come together with pantry staples. Serve them with coffee or wrap them up as edible gifts—they look like tiny snowballs and taste like sweet bliss.
What Kind of Nuts Work Best in Vegan Russian Tea Cakes?
Traditionally, Russian Tea Cakes use finely chopped walnuts or pecans, but almonds and hazelnuts work just as well. The key is to use raw, unsalted nuts and to toast them slightly before adding them to the dough for deeper flavor. Pecans tend to be softer and more buttery, while walnuts offer a slight bitterness that balances the sweetness.

Ingredients for the Vegan Russian Tea Cakes
Vegan Butter – Essential for that rich, buttery texture. Use a stick-form vegan butter, not spreadable from a tub, for best results.
Powdered Sugar – Adds sweetness and gives the cookies their iconic snow-dusted finish. You’ll use it in the dough and for rolling after baking.
All-Purpose Flour – The base of the cookie. It provides structure without making them too dense.
Vanilla Extract – A touch of warmth and depth. Pure vanilla makes a big difference.
Chopped Nuts – Pecans or walnuts are classic. They bring texture and flavor to every bite.
Salt – Just a pinch to balance out the sweetness and enhance the nutty notes.
How To Make the Vegan Russian Tea Cakes
Step 1: Cream the Butter and Sugar
In a large mixing bowl, cream together the vegan butter and powdered sugar until light and fluffy. This takes about 2–3 minutes with a hand mixer. This step builds the cookie’s tender texture.
Step 2: Add Vanilla and Dry Ingredients
Mix in the vanilla extract, followed by the flour and salt. Stir until just combined, being careful not to overmix. The dough will be soft and slightly crumbly.
Step 3: Fold in the Nuts
Add the chopped nuts and gently fold them into the dough using a spatula or your hands. Chill the dough for 30 minutes to help it hold shape when baking.
Step 4: Roll and Bake
Preheat the oven to 350°F (175°C). Line a baking sheet with parchment paper. Roll the chilled dough into 1-inch balls and place them 1 inch apart. Bake for 12–14 minutes or until the bottoms are lightly golden.
Step 5: Sugar Dusting Time
Let the cookies cool for 5 minutes, then roll them in powdered sugar while still warm. Once completely cooled, roll them again for that signature snowy finish.
How to Serve and Store Vegan Russian Tea Cakes
Serve these cookies with tea, coffee, or even alongside a scoop of dairy-free ice cream. They’re also perfect for gifting—just pack them in a festive tin or glass jar for a charming homemade present.
Store them in an airtight container at room temperature for up to one week. For longer storage, freeze them without the final powdered sugar coating and dust after thawing. They maintain their delicate texture and flavor beautifully.
Frequently Asked Questions
Can I freeze the dough in advance?
Yes! Shape the dough into balls and freeze them on a baking sheet. Once frozen, transfer to a freezer bag. Bake from frozen, adding a minute or two to the baking time.
Are these cookies gluten-free?
The base recipe isn’t gluten-free, but you can substitute a 1:1 gluten-free flour blend with xanthan gum for a similar result.
What can I use instead of nuts?
If you’re nut-free, try using sunflower seeds or pumpkin seeds finely chopped. The texture will differ, but they still provide crunch and flavor.
Can I double the recipe?
Absolutely. This recipe scales well, making it ideal for big batches during the holidays or parties.
Why are my cookies spreading too much?
Most likely your butter was too soft or melted. Make sure to chill the dough and use stick vegan butter for best results.
Want More Cookie Ideas with a Twist?
If you love these Vegan Russian Tea Cakes, here are a few more cookie recipes you might enjoy:
- Condensed Milk Snow Cookies for another melt-in-your-mouth treat.
- Lemon Churro Cookies if you like citrus with a cinnamon sugar punch.
- Caramel Cheesecake Cookies for a gooey and tangy dessert bite.
- Brown Sugar Maple Cookies with warm fall flavors.
- Zesty Lemon Oatmeal No-Bake Cookies for an easy oven-free option.
Save This Pin + Share Your Results
📌 Save this recipe to your Pinterest dessert board so you can come back to it any time. Follow more sweet inspiration here.
And let me know in the comments how yours turned out. Did you go with walnuts or pecans? Did you dust them once or twice?
I love seeing how you all make these your own. Don’t hesitate to share your tips or ask questions—let’s bake better together!

Vegan Russian Tea Cakes
- Total Time: 24 minutes
- Yield: 24 cookies
- Diet: Vegan
Description
Tender, nutty, and rolled in snowy powdered sugar, these Vegan Russian Tea Cakes are a holiday classic made completely dairy- and egg-free. With just a few pantry ingredients, these melt-in-your-mouth cookies come together quickly for gifting, tea time, or any cozy occasion.
Ingredients
1 cup vegan butter
½ cup powdered sugar
2 teaspoons vanilla extract
2 ¼ cups all-purpose flour
¼ teaspoon salt
¾ cup finely chopped pecans or walnuts
1 cup powdered sugar (for coating)
Instructions
1. Preheat the oven to 350°F (175°C) and line a baking sheet with parchment paper.
2. In a large bowl, cream the vegan butter and ½ cup powdered sugar until light and fluffy (2–3 minutes).
3. Mix in vanilla extract. Add flour and salt, then stir until just combined.
4. Fold in the chopped nuts until evenly distributed. Chill the dough for 30 minutes.
5. Roll dough into 1-inch balls and place 1 inch apart on the baking sheet.
6. Bake for 12–14 minutes, or until bottoms are lightly golden.
7. Let cookies cool for 5 minutes. While still warm, roll them in powdered sugar.
8. Once completely cooled, roll them again in powdered sugar for a snowy finish.
Notes
For best results, use stick-form vegan butter (not from a tub) to ensure proper texture.
Chill the dough before baking to prevent the cookies from spreading too much.
Powdered sugar sticks better when cookies are warm, but do a second coating after they cool.
- Prep Time: 10 minutes
- Cook Time: 14 minutes
- Category: Dessert
- Method: Baking
- Cuisine: American
Nutrition
- Serving Size: 1 cookie
- Calories: 140
- Sugar: 5g
- Sodium: 55mg
- Fat: 10g
- Saturated Fat: 3g
- Unsaturated Fat: 6g
- Trans Fat: 0g
- Carbohydrates: 13g
- Fiber: 1g
- Protein: 1g
- Cholesterol: 0mg


